4   C A L I B R AT I O N 
 
4.1 
Important Information on Meter Calibration  
Your meter has five measuring ranges. You can calibrate one point in each of the measuring 
ranges (up to five points). If you are measuring values in more than one range, make sure to 
calibrate each of the ranges you are measuring.  
 
To view current calibration points, see SETUP section Program 2.0 on page 28.  
 
The following table lists the corresponding conductivity and TDS ranges. You should calibrate 
each range using a solution that falls between the values in the “recommended calibration 
solution range” column.

When you recalibrate your meter, old calibrations are replaced on a range by range basis. For 
example, if you previously calibrated your conductivity meter at 1413 
µS in the 0 to 1999 µS 
range and you recalibrate at 1500 
µS (also in the 0 to 1999 µS range), the meter will replace 
the old calibration data (1413 
µS) in that range. The meter will retain all calibration data in 
other ranges.  
 
To completely recalibrate your meter, or when you use a replacement probe, it is best to clear 
all calibration data in memory. To erase all the old conductivity and TDS calibration data 
completely from memory, see SETUP section Program 8.0 on page 39.
